Jenny Domiano, MOT, LOTR

Jenny Domiano, MOT, LOTR

Founder & CEO,

Occupational Therapist

  • Bio

    Jenny is originally from Texas and graduated from Stephen F. Austin State University with a bachelor's degree in rehabilitation services. She then went on to earn her master's degree from Texas Woman's University in Houston. Jenny has worked as an occupational therapist for 26 years in a variety of practice areas, including mental health, brain injury rehabilitation, ergonomics, and pediatrics, where she has truly found her calling. She has worked extensively with children at Children's Hospital, as an Early Steps provider, in schools, and at our outpatient clinic. Her pediatric specialties include infant, toddler, and child feeding, sensory processing, handwriting, reflex integration, and behavior regulation. Raymond Noel, MOT/LOTR

Raymond Noel, MOT, LOTR

Occupational Therapist

  • Bio

    Ray began his journey at TLC in June of 2022. He graduated from Louisiana State University with a bachelor’s degree in psychology before beginning his career in pediatrics in the Greater New Orleans area. His several years of pediatric experience include working closely with clients with autism spectrum disorder and other developmental disorders in the school and home settings. Ray went on to earn his master’s in occupational therapy from Louisiana State University Health Sciences Center. His fieldwork rotations ranged from ICU Acute Care to outpatient pediatrics, where he gained experience implementing child-led therapy through a DIR/Floortime model. Ray works full-time between the school system and treating individual clients and groups at our Metairie and Elmwood clinics.
